Microsoft's own PowerToys includes . It is not a true tiling window manager, but it is the most accessible entry point. You define zones on your screen (e.g., a large zone on the left, two stacked zones on the right). Then, when you drag a window while holding Shift , it snaps perfectly into a zone.
